Synopsis:
The CERN (Central European Research Network) a European organization for Nuclear Research made one of the most dangerous substance on earth that can annihilate an entire city , it is said to be the beginning of everything, the anti-matter. Meanwhile the entire Catholic Church mourns the death of the Pope and days after his death a conclave has been called for to nominate the new Pope. Four of the pointiffs, 4 cardinals composed the candidates based on seniority but even before the before the voting they were all kidnapped. The Vatican received a threat that they will be killed one by one all as part of retribution for what the Church did with its long time enemy the Illuminati. But the Illuminati has been long time extinct or was it? Symbologist Robert Langdon was summoned to solve this mystery.

Characters:
Tom Hanks – Robert Langdon
Ewan McGregor – Camerlengo Patrick McKenna
Ayelet Zurer –  Vittoria Vetra
Stellan Skarsgård – Commander Richter
Pierfrancesco Favino – Inspector Olivetti
Nikolaj Lie Kaas –  Assassin

    there is no series, only the two novels having in common nothing but the main character and the author’s issues with Catholic Church.
    the other two, Digital Fortress and Deception Point, have no connection whatsoever, neither between them, nor with the other two. besides, they differ so much from the spiritual environment of Angels and Demons and The DaVinci code, they have a totally scientific approach, sometimes too technical for some ppl taste…
    oh, and the chronological order of his writing the novels is: Digital Fortress (1998), Angels & Demons (2000), Deception Point (2001) and The Da Vinci Code (2003). The Lost Symbol is due in September 2009.
